NOVELTY - Preparation method of cellulose-based oxygen barrier moisture permeable antibacterial fresh-keeping film involves mixing urea, alkali and deionized water in proportion to prepare alkali/urea aqueous solution. Adding inorganic filler to the obtained alkali/urea aqueous solution, and dispersing to obtain a dispersion. Cooling down to -14--10 degreesC, then adding cellulose into it, stirring to obtain a mixed solution, and centrifuge to remove air bubbles. Spreading out on a glass plate by a casting method, and soak in a coagulation bath to obtain a regenerated cellulose hydrogel. After rinsing the regenerated cellulose hydrogel with deionized water, and drying to obtain a regenerated cellulose-based composite membrane. Soaking the dried cellulose composite film in the modifier dispersion liquid for surface hydrophobic modification, then thoroughly rinsing with water, drying at room temperature, and then hot pressing. USE - Preparation method of cellulose-based oxygen barrier moisture permeable antibacterial fresh-keeping film used for food packaging, functional materials, and the like. ADVANTAGE - Cellulose-based oxygen barrier moisture permeable antibacterial fresh-keeping film has high oxygen barrier property even under high humidity, excellent mechanical property and optical property and adjustable thickness, preservation, moisture permeability, antibacterial property, no mildew.
